WebAug 16, 2024 · 4G Control and User Plane Separation (CUPS) EPC The separation of Control and User Plane for the 4G architecture was introduced with 3GPP Release 14. It separated the packet gateways into control and user planes allowing for more flexible deployment and independent scaling achieving benefits in both, CapEx and OpEx. It includes a plethora of canned plug-and-play test … WebOct 27, 2024 · Control and User Plane Separation of EPC nodes (CUPS) is one of the main Work Items of 3GPP Release 14. CUPS separate control & user plane from S-GW, P-GW & TDF. TDF is Traffic Detection Function that was introduced together with the Sd reference point as means for traffic management in Release 11.

MEC is an ETSI term that pre-dates CUPS standardization, which is itself a 3GPP term that takes a slightly broader view of how to effectively implement and … WebCUPS architecture for EPC was first introduced in 3GPP release 14. All earlier EPC specification follows NON-CUPS architecture. CUPS introduce 3 new interfaces, Sxa, Sxb and Sxc between the CP and UP functions of the SGW, PGW, and TDF respectively.
